Dear Rosies,

In a world that never turns the lights off, what happens when you willingly choose complete, uninterrupted dark?

Joining us for today’s Rose Woman conversation is Meghan Elfsten. She is the Director of OMYA Dark Retreats, a California Associate Marriage and Family Therapist (AMFT), and holds a Master’s degree in Counseling Psychology.

Drawing from her own life-changing time in extended darkness, Meghan became deeply devoted to the question: What becomes possible when we remove all external stimulation and finally listen to the body? Dark Retreats create highly supported, trauma-aware containers where participants can safely turn inward, meet long-buried parts of themselves, and access deeper layers of emotional and embodied healing, without plant medicine, performance, or spiritual bypass.

What is a dark retreat?
A dark retreat is a stay in complete, uninterrupted darkness, undertaken in a supported and trauma-aware setting. Removing all external stimulation lets the nervous system settle and turns attention inward, toward what the body has been carrying. Traditions across many lineages have used enclosure this way for centuries.
What is a gray retreat?
A gray retreat is a gentler entry point than full darkness, for people drawn to the practice who are not ready for total dark or who would rather begin gradually. It is discussed as an option in this episode alongside the standard structure.
Is a dark retreat safe for everyone?
It should only be done in a supported, trauma-aware container with trained facilitation — Meghan Elfsten is a California Associate Marriage and Family Therapist with a Master's degree in Counseling Psychology. Extended darkness can surface buried material. If you live with a mental-health condition, discuss it with your own clinician before booking.
